Polyfunctionalized biphenyl and heteroaromatic compounds were formed in the presence of [Co(acac) 2 ], Bu 4 NI, and 4‐fluorostyrene ( 3 ) through a smooth cross‐coupling reaction between organocopper reagents 1 , prepared by the transmetalation of functionalized aryl magnesium halides with CuCN⋅2 LiCl, and aryl halides 2 that bear electron‐withdrawing substituents. acac=acetylacetonate, DME=1,2‐dimethoxyethane, DMPU=1,3‐dimethyl‐3,4,5,6‐tetrahydro‐2(1 H )‐pyrimidinone.
